[su_service title=”Section 1: How To Create Margin” icon=”icon: heart” icon_color=”#bc377c”]Even as you read this post, you are experiencing margin. Margin is the space on either side of the print with nothing–nothing but white. Space where you might add an occasional note or pause to absorb what you read. Margin isn’t necessary only in publishing, margin is necessary for contentment in our lives. We need empty space, room for God to move, and time to process what we’re experiencing and learning. People living without margin are overwhelmed, maxed out and usually in need of therapy![/su_service]

[/su_service] [su_button url=”http://www.womenoffaith.com/2014/12/still/” background=”#ffffff” color=”#d16969″ size=”5″ wide=”yes”]Being Still[/su_button] [su_button url=”http://www.faithbarista.com/2014/09/soul-rest-sunday-only-when-i-am-alone-with-you/” background=”#ffffff” color=”#d16969″ size=”5″ wide=”yes”]Whenever I’m Alone With You[/su_button] [su_button url=”http://girlfriendsingod.com/the-power-of-quiet/” background=”#ffffff” color=”#d16969″ size=”5″ wide=”yes”]The Power of Quiet[/su_button] [su_button url=”http://www.todayschristianwoman.com/articles/2015/july/desperate-for-break.html” background=”#ffffff” color=”#d16969″ size=”5″ wide=”yes”]Desperate for a Break?[/su_button] [su_service title=”Chapter 6: How To Understand and Embrace Real Sabbath” icon=”icon: asterisk” icon_color=”#9a94f2″ size=”26″]Six days it took God to create the earth and it inhabitants from nothing and on the seventh day, He rested. God met with Moses and along with nine other commandments insisted on a day for rest. Instead of a luxury or a polite suggestion, God gave the command for Sabbath because God understands how crucial rest is our to our physical, mental, emotional and spiritual health. We’ve bought into the lie that if we have the “package” others will love us and God will accept us.[/su_service]   [su_button url=”http://holleygerth.com/pursue-excellence-skip-perfection/” background=”#ffffff” color=”#d16969″ size=”5″ wide=”yes”]Why You Can Pursue Excellence and Skip Perfection[/su_button] [su_button url=”http://holleygerth.com/lower-your-expectations/” background=”#ffffff” color=”#d16969″ size=”5″ wide=”yes”]Lower Your Expectations[/su_button] [su_button url=”http://www.todayschristianwoman.com/articles/2014/august-week-1/right-sizing-desires.html” background=”#ffffff” color=”#d16969″ size=”5″ wide=”yes”]Right-Sizing Desires[/su_button] [su_button url=”http://sallyclarkson.com/choosing-to-live-by-grace-not-perfection/” background=”#ffffff” color=”#d16969″ size=”5″ wide=”yes”]Choosing To Live By Grace Not Perfection[/su_button]   [su_service title=”Chapter 8: How To Trust God While You Wait” icon=”icon: asterisk” icon_color=”#9a94f2″ size=”26″]In society of instant messaging and microwavable meals, waiting isn’t easy. It isn’t so much the wait in line at the store or at the bus stop for a ride, it is the wait for God’s timing. It is the wait for a spouse, a baby, a job promotion or the next season of life. Waiting is hard. Yet, as followers of God, we are called to wait…to follow not to run ahead. Experience deep spiritual fulfillment requires trust God and His timing.
